Eric Biggers 8ba60c5914 lib/crypto: x86/blake2s: Use vpternlogd for 3-input XORs
AVX-512 supports 3-input XORs via the vpternlogd (or vpternlogq)
instruction with immediate 0x96.  This approach, vs. the alternative of
two vpxor instructions, is already used in the CRC, AES-GCM, and AES-XTS
code, since it reduces the instruction count and is faster on some CPUs.
Make blake2s_compress_avx512() take advantage of it too.

Eric Biggers cd5528621a lib/crypto: x86/blake2s: Avoid writing back unchanged 'f' value
Just before returning, blake2s_compress_ssse3() and
blake2s_compress_avx512() store updated values to the 'h', 't', and 'f'
fields of struct blake2s_ctx.  But 'f' is always unchanged (which is
correct; only the C code changes it).  So, there's no need to write to
'f'.  Use 64-bit stores (movq and vmovq) instead of 128-bit stores
(movdqu and vmovdqu) so that only 't' is written.

Eric Biggers c19bdf24cc lib/crypto: x86/blake2s: Drop check for nblocks == 0
Since blake2s_compress() is always passed nblocks != 0, remove the
unnecessary check for nblocks == 0 from blake2s_compress_ssse3().

Note that this makes it consistent with blake2s_compress_avx512() in the
same file as well as the arm32 blake2s_compress().

Eric Biggers 2f22115709 lib/crypto: x86/blake2s: Fix 32-bit arg treated as 64-bit
In the C code, the 'inc' argument to the assembly functions
blake2s_compress_ssse3() and blake2s_compress_avx512() is declared with
type u32, matching blake2s_compress().  The assembly code then reads it
from the 64-bit %rcx.  However, the ABI doesn't guarantee zero-extension
to 64 bits, nor do gcc or clang guarantee it.  Therefore, fix these
functions to read this argument from the 32-bit %ecx.

In theory, this bug could have caused the wrong 'inc' value to be used,
causing incorrect BLAKE2s hashes.  In practice, probably not: I've fixed
essentially this same bug in many other assembly files too, but there's
never been a real report of it having caused a problem.  In x86_64, all
writes to 32-bit registers are zero-extended to 64 bits.  That results
in zero-extension in nearly all situations.  I've only been able to
demonstrate a lack of zero-extension with a somewhat contrived example
involving truncation, e.g. when the C code has a u64 variable holding
0x1234567800000040 and passes it as a u32 expecting it to be truncated
to 0x40 (64).  But that's not what the real code does, of course.

Eric Biggers 453eda46b7 lib/crypto: x86/blake2s: Reduce size of BLAKE2S_SIGMA2
Save 480 bytes of .rodata by replacing the .long constants with .bytes,
and using the vpmovzxbd instruction to expand them.

Also update the code to do the loads before incrementing %rax rather
than after.  This avoids the need for the first load to use an offset.

Eric Biggers 74750aa78d lib/crypto: x86: Move arch/x86/lib/crypto/ into lib/crypto/
Move the contents of arch/x86/lib/crypto/ into lib/crypto/x86/.

The new code organization makes a lot more sense for how this code
actually works and is developed.  In particular, it makes it possible to
build each algorithm as a single module, with better inlining and dead
code elimination.  For a more detailed explanation, see the patchset
which did this for the CRC library code:
